Replica and Checkpoints are a lot more … WebJul 11, 2011 · Creating a Hyper-V snapshot. Creating a snapshot in Hyper-V is an extremely easy process. To do so, open the Hyper-V Manager, right click on the VM for which you want to create a snapshot, and choose the Snapshot command from the shortcut menu. Hyper-V snapshots should be merged in a specific order: from child to parent. Therefore, it’s essential to arrange the checkpoint tree in the correct order of the snapshot creation process: from the newest to the oldest ones. self hosted photo storage
